The Acumanage Method
 
The Acumanage Method is a systemic management methodology that combines market research with logical planning, marketing, execution and quality management to obtain expected results through ethical business practices.
 
Today’s customers expect products and services that meet their needs in a sustained, effective and efficient manner. Companies, too, are expected to function efficiently and effectively and to provide value for the prices they charge. Society at large expects companies to apply ethical principles in dealing with employees, in managing their finances and salary scales, and in the marketing of their products, in addition to being efficient and effective.
 
The financial crisis of the beginning of the 21st Century has produced major paradoxes where some businesses and multinationals control large sections of the world’s markets. Having gone through deep restructuring they have revolutionised the labour market, laying off large numbers of people who have not been able to keep pace with a technologically driven and changing economy. Producing more with less has become the norm. Furthermore, the communications revolution and the over-marketing of “the latest product” – not necessarily the “best” or “needed” – have created new, reasonable and unreasonable demands, leading to a culture of “consumerism”.
 
Millions of SMEs and start-up companies have mushroomed in old and emerging economies around the planet. During the last thirty years, some have had outstanding success, many have survived and a considerable number of them have failed. Investors, managers and employees have lived through the collapse of ideologies and the failure of economic schemes in existence since the end of World War II that were apparently too strong to fail.
 
The myriad of management techniques appearing since Edward Deming’s post-war influence in reviving the Japanese industry has led to a jargon jungle that has blurred the understanding of efficient, effective and ethical management. While most of the management gurus that subsequently appeared expanded the understanding of management science, they also added their own particularities – not always sufficiently clear – to help the layman channel new techniques in the proper direction. Many came up with damaging shortcuts, easy ways to make a buck with little or no care for the impact that such “solutions” might cause.
 
Today, a review of the learning acquired in more than half a century of successful and unsuccessful trials is needed to elucidate the basic, what really works or doesn’t work, to help leaders and managers apply old and new techniques that assure effective execution within the framework of good management.
 
The Acumanage Method therefore, is a Management methodology that focuses on Efficiency, Effectiveness and Ethics providing essential tools required to identify customers’ real needs and to produce services and products that respond to those needs. The method‘s design, planning and execution tools, added to introducing new process dynamics, help users interact effectively with decision-making so that products together with meeting customer requirements and expectations are also feasible and can be properly marketed. Leaders and managers will find that The Acumange Method provides them with all the tools required to ensure that every process within the company or organization produces quality outputs at every level and supports a sustainable and successful future..
